The kitchen remodeling market in Albany, NY, is competitive and features a mix of large, established design-build firms, specialized kitchen and bath studios, and skilled independent contractors. The overall quality is high, with numerous providers holding certifications from manufacturers (like CKBD - Certified Kitchen & Bath Designer) and industry associations. Competition helps maintain strong customer service standards. Pricing in the Albany area is generally moderate for the Northeast. A full, mid-range kitchen remodel typically starts in the $25,000 - $40,000 range, while high-end custom projects with layout changes and premium materials (e.g., custom cabinetry, natural stone counters) can easily exceed $75,000. Homeowners are advised to obtain multiple quotes and verify licensing and insurance for any provider they consider.

In the Capital Region, a full kitchen remodel typically ranges from $25,000 to $70,000+, with mid-range projects averaging $40,000-$60,000. Costs are influenced by material choices, layout changes, and local labor rates. It's important to budget an additional 10-20% for contingencies, especially in older Albany homes where unexpected issues like outdated wiring or plumbing are common.
Albany's distinct four-season climate significantly affects scheduling. Winter projects can face delays due to snow and ice, impacting material delivery and subcontractor travel. Many homeowners prefer to schedule demolition and major construction in spring or fall to avoid peak humidity in summer, which can affect drying times for drywall and paint, and the deep freeze of winter.
Yes, Albany and its suburbs have specific building codes. Most remodels requiring electrical, plumbing, or structural changes will need permits from your local building department (City of Albany or town-specific). A reputable local contractor will handle this, ensuring compliance with New York State building codes and any local ordinances, which is crucial for safety and future home resale.

In Albany's many historic and mid-century homes, common surprises include knob-and-tube wiring, outdated galvanized steel plumbing pipes, insufficient insulation, and uneven or damaged subfloors. A thorough inspection by your contractor before finalizing plans is essential to identify these issues, which must be addressed to meet current codes and ensure the longevity and safety of your new kitchen.
